Passiflora hahnii
Family: Passifloraceae
What it is like
A vine. The leaves are simple but have lobes. The fruit are round and 3-4 cm across. They are deep purple.
Where it is found
It is a tropical plant.
Countries/locations it is found in
Central America, Colombia, Mexico, Panama
